1/29/2022 0 Comments What Is Water Filtering?Water filtering is a process for cleaning your water by straining out contaminants. The filters work by forcing water through a membrane with tiny holes. These holes are typically 0.2 microns in size, which is large enough for water molecules to pass through, but small enough to trap sediment, bacteria, and protozoa. While larger holes allow more contaminants to pass through, smaller ones need more suction. This process can take a long time, and is only effective for removing the most common contaminants. The most common household water filter uses activated carbon granules, which are made from charcoal. The charcoal is a porous form of carbon that is made from burning wood in reduced oxygen. The surface area of activated carbon granules is huge, and it's easy for chemicals to stick to it, so activated carbon filters are an excellent choice for purifying water.
